Arbil (EBL) to Riyadh (RUH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Erbil International Airport (EBL) in Arbil, Iraq to King Khaled International Airport (RUH) in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ia is 1,281 kilometers (796 miles / 692 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ying south southeast at a heading of 167°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Iraq with Saudi Arabia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 17:56 in Arbil, it's 17:56 in Riyadh.

The return flight from Riyadh (RUH) to Arbil (EBL) follows a heading of 349° (north).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
